Qatar- DMIS marks Teachers' Day with special events


(MENAFN- The Peninsula) The Peninsula

A special programme was organised at the DMIS CPD area on Teachers' Day. All teachers dressed in traditional attire participated in the celebrations that started with music, inspiring talk, solo singing and was finally followed by choir singing. All teachers enthusiastically participated in the program me which showcased their talents other than teaching.
All teachers were presented a token of appreciation by the School Principal.
Principal Rakesh Singh Tomar shared his thoughts on the occasion and applauded the contribution of each teacher. He emphasised that every teacher needed to carry out his or her responsibilities with passion which is grounded in pre-class preparation and thinking.
'The more we work on it the more excitement and passion become the part of the profession, he said. He also advised the teachers to take an oath to re-dedicate themselves for the cause of education and keep transforming and inspiring students for a bright future.
On behalf of the School Management, Director and Students, Principal wished all the teachers a very happy Teachers' Day.
